- Mileage: Check the odometer to get an idea of how much the scooter has been ridden. Higher mileage isn't necessarily a deal-breaker, but it's important to consider it in relation to the scooter's age and overall condition.
- Service History: Ask the seller for service records to see if the scooter has been properly maintained. Regular oil changes, tune-ups, and other maintenance tasks are essential for keeping the scooter running smoothly.
- Cosmetic Condition: Examine the scooter for any signs of damage, such as scratches, dents, or rust. While minor cosmetic issues may not affect performance, they can be an indication of how well the scooter has been cared for.
- Mechanical Condition: Start the engine and listen for any unusual noises. Check the brakes, lights, and other essential components to ensure they are working properly. Take the scooter for a test ride to assess its handling and performance.
- Tire Condition: Inspect the tires for wear and tear. Worn tires can affect handling and safety, so it's important to replace them if necessary.
- Paperwork: Make sure the seller has the proper paperwork, including the title and registration. Verify that the V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) matches the paperwork.
- Engine: Listen for any unusual noises, such as knocking or rattling. Check for leaks around the engine seals. If possible, have a mechanic perform a compression test to assess the engine's health.
- Transmission: The automatic transmission should shift smoothly without any hesitation or slipping. If you notice any problems, it could be a sign of a costly repair.
- Brakes: Check the brake pads for wear and tear. Make sure the brakes engage smoothly and provide adequate stopping power. If the scooter has ABS, verify that it is functioning properly.
- Suspension: Inspect the suspension for leaks or damage. Bounce the scooter to check for excessive play or stiffness.
- Frame: Look for any signs of damage or rust on the frame. A damaged frame can compromise the scooter's structural integrity.
- Why are you selling the scooter? This question can provide valuable insights into the scooter's history and potential issues.
- How often was the scooter serviced? Regular maintenance is crucial for keeping the scooter running smoothly.
- Has the scooter ever been in an accident? Accidents can cause hidden damage that may not be immediately apparent.
- Are there any known issues with the scooter? Be upfront about any potential problems, no matter how minor they may seem.
- Can I take the scooter for a test ride? A test ride is essential for assessing the scooter's handling and performance.

- Do Your Research: Before making an offer, research the market value of similar scooters in your area. This will give you a good starting point for negotiations.
- Be Polite and Respectful: Treat the seller with courtesy and respect, even if you disagree on the price. A positive attitude can go a long way in reaching a mutually agreeable deal.
- Point Out Any Flaws: If you notice any flaws or issues with the scooter, point them out to the seller and use them as leverage to negotiate a lower price.
- Be Prepared to Walk Away: Don't be afraid to walk away if the seller is unwilling to negotiate a fair price. There are plenty of other scooters out there, so don't feel pressured to make a purchase you're not comfortable with.
- Offer a Fair Price: Make a reasonable offer based on the scooter's condition, mileage, and market value. Avoid lowballing the seller, as this can damage the negotiation process.

Performance and Handling
The performance of the Vespa GTS 300 Super Sport is where it truly shines. The 300cc engine provides ample power for zipping through traffic and maintaining comfortable speeds on the open road. It's not just about raw power; the engine is also incredibly smooth and responsive, making it a joy to ride in various conditions. The automatic transmission means no shifting gears – just twist the throttle and go! Handling is another key strength of the GTS 300 Super Sport. The scooter feels nimble and agile, allowing you to easily maneuver through tight spaces and navigate crowded streets. The suspension system is well-tuned, providing a comfortable ride even on less-than-perfect road surfaces. Whether you're a seasoned rider or new to scooters, you'll appreciate the confidence-inspiring handling of the GTS 300 Super Sport. It strikes a perfect balance between stability and agility, making it fun and easy to ride in a wide range of situations. The combination of performance and handling makes the Vespa GTS 300 Super Sport a versatile scooter that's equally at home in the city and on the open road. The scooter's braking system is also top-notch, providing reliable stopping power when you need it most. With features like ABS (Anti-lock Braking System) on some models, you can ride with added confidence, knowing that you have an extra layer of safety.
